How To Catch A Cheater

Discovering that your partner is cheating can be a devastating experience. If you suspect your partner may be unfaithful, it’s important to gather evidence before confronting them. While it’s never easy to face infidelity, knowing the truth can help you make decisions about your relationship. Here are some tips on how to catch a cheater:

1. Look for Changes in Behavior

One of the first signs that your partner may be cheating is a change in their behavior. They may become more secretive, distant, or defensive when asked about their whereabouts. Keep an eye out for the following red flags:

  • Increased Secrecy: Your partner may start hiding their phone or computer, or password protect their devices.
  • Changes in Routine: They may suddenly start working late or going out with friends more frequently.
  • Mood Swings: If your partner seems more irritable or distant than usual, it could be a sign of guilt.

2. Check Their Phone and Social Media

Another way to catch a cheater is to look through their phone and social media accounts. While invading their privacy should be a last resort, it can provide valuable insight into their activities. Keep an eye out for:

  • Deleted Messages: If your partner frequently deletes their text messages or calls, they may be hiding something.
  • New Contacts: Pay attention to any new names or numbers that appear in their contacts list.
  • Suspicious Activity: Check their social media accounts for unusual activity, such as late-night messaging or secretive behavior.

3. Hire a Private Investigator

If you’re unable to gather evidence on your own, consider hiring a private investigator to help you catch a cheater. These professionals are trained to conduct surveillance and gather information discreetly. They can provide you with concrete proof of infidelity, which can be crucial in confronting your partner.

4. Monitor Their Location

Modern technology has made it easier than ever to track someone’s whereabouts. If you suspect your partner may be lying about their location, consider using GPS tracking software to monitor their movements. This can help you determine if they are being honest about where they are going.

5. Talk to Their Friends and Family

If you’re unsure how to catch a cheater on your own, consider reaching out to your partner’s friends or family members. They may have valuable insights or information that can help you uncover the truth. Be cautious, however, as your partner may have already involved them in their deception.

6. Consider Couples Therapy

If you’ve gathered evidence of infidelity and are preparing to confront your partner, consider seeking couples therapy. A therapist can help facilitate a difficult conversation and provide guidance on how to move forward. They can also help you navigate the emotions that come with discovering betrayal.

7. Confront Your Partner

Once you have gathered sufficient evidence of infidelity, it’s time to confront your partner. Choose a time and place where you can have a private conversation. Be prepared for denial, anger, or tears, but stay calm and focused on presenting your evidence. Remember to prioritize your emotional well-being and safety above all else.

8. Decide on the Next Steps

After confronting your partner, it’s important to decide on the next steps for your relationship. Consider whether you want to work through the infidelity together, take a break, or end the relationship altogether. Trust your instincts and prioritize your own emotional well-being throughout the process.
